40 | <refsect1> | |
41 | <title>Description</title> | |
42 | ||
43 | <para><function>sd_bus_message_copy()</function> copies the contents from | |
44 | message <parameter>source</parameter> to <parameter>m</parameter>. If | |
45 | <parameter>all</parameter> is false, a single complete type is copied | |
46 | (basic or container). If <parameter>all</parameter> is true, the contents | |
47 | are copied until the end of the currently open container or the end | |
48 | of <parameter>source</parameter>.</para> | |
49 | </refsect1> | |
50 | ||
51 | <refsect1> | |
52 | <title>Return Value</title> | |
53 | ||
54 | <para>On success, this call returns true if anything was copied, and false if | |
55 | there was nothing to copy. On failure, it returns a negative errno-style error | |
56 | code.</para> | |
57 | </refsect1> | |
58 | ||
59 | <refsect1 id='errors'> | |
60 | <title>Errors</title> | |
61 | ||
62 | <para>Returned errors may indicate the following problems:</para> | |
63 | ||
64 | <variablelist> | |
65 | ||
66 | <varlistentry> | |
67 | <term><constant>-EINVAL</constant></term> | |
68 | ||
69 | <listitem><para><parameter>source</parameter> or <parameter>m</parameter> are | |
70 | <constant>NULL</constant>.</para></listitem> | |
71 | </varlistentry> | |
72 | ||
73 | <varlistentry> | |
74 | <term><constant>-EPERM</constant></term> | |
75 | ||
76 | <listitem><para>Message <parameter>m</parameter> has been sealed or | |
77 | <parameter>source</parameter> has <emphasis>not</emphasis> been sealed. | |
78 | </para></listitem> | |
79 | </varlistentry> | |
80 | ||
81 | <varlistentry> | |
82 | <term><constant>-ESTALE</constant></term> | |
83 | ||
84 | <listitem><para>Destination message is in invalid state. | |
85 | </para></listitem> | |
86 | </varlistentry> | |
87 | ||
88 | <varlistentry> | |
89 | <term><constant>-ENXIO</constant></term> | |
90 | ||
91 | <listitem><para>Destination message cannot be appended to. | |
92 | </para></listitem> | |
93 | </varlistentry> | |
94 | ||
95 | <varlistentry> | |
96 | <term><constant>-ENOMEM</constant></term> | |
97 | ||
98 | <listitem><para>Memory allocation failed.</para></listitem> | |
99 | </varlistentry> | |
100 | </variablelist> | |
101 | </refsect1> | |
